Why We Froze Osun Government Bank Accounts – EFCC

The Economic and Financial Crimes Commission, EFCC, has defended its decision to freeze the Osun State Government’s bank accounts. The commission recently had its say via a statement by its Head of Media and Publicity, Dele Oyewale, and Nigerians have been reacting.

Revealing that it had been investigating the Osun State Government since March 2026 over the alleged fraudulent handling of Ecology Funds, Intervention Funds and allocations from the Federation Account Allocation Committee, FAAC, EFCC disclosed that the action was aimed at stopping the alleged diversion of N11 billion in public funds.

Dele added that the account freeze has nothing to do with the state’s forthcoming governorship election.

His words, “The Commission cannot watch idly while a state government’s account is being pillaged.

These ongoing investigations of the state government would not have warranted any placement of Post No Debit order on its account but for the precipitate and unwarranted movement of funds from the accounts to different suspicious accounts since August 2, 2026.

The Commission noticed huge transfers of funds into different corporate entities and had to swiftly halt the trend by freezing the accounts from which such heavy funds are being moved.

While the Commission is fully aware of the impending governorship election in Osun State, it has a responsibility to act in defence of the sanctity of the funds of the state. It will be uncharitable for the Commission to allow an excuse of an upcoming election to fold its arms to perform its legally-assigned functions.

It is equally needful to state that the Commission is keeping watch over the finances of other states like Osun State. Many of these states are on the investigative radar of the Commission to ensure accountability and probity.”
